Square-Enix has stated that they’re planning a launch event for the next installment in the Kingdom Hearts Series, Kingdom Hearts: Dream Drop Distance. That’s all we know right now, aside from the fact that it’ll be in Tokyo, but maybe we’ll get some cool stuff out of it.
I want Square-Enix to announced another 10th Anniversary Collection that contains Kingdom Hearts 1 and 2, the remake of the GBA game Chain of Memories and the PSP game Birth By Sleep; because that 3DS/DS Collection is insultingly disappointing. Hopefully they’ll announce a release date for places outside of Japan too, so we’ll know when to start saving.
Dream Drop Distance drops into Japan on March 29th.
